This pandemic has changed how we live, and people who need mental health support will need it more than they ever have. We've literally isolated everybody - so what happens when you feel alone at the best of times? 

For 48 hours over Easter weekend, I'm doing my interactive, live-action videogame stand-up show The Dark Room at twitch.tv/robbotron as a tribute to the work Mind does, and for the NHS workers and volunteers helping us get through this awful time (see separate NHS donations page: https://www.justgiving.com/fundraising/thedarkroomnhs)

I have lost too many friends and family to suicide - and isolation can be an incredible trigger for that. Please help me fund a charity that gets mental health help where it needs to go.

This will be two days of a show the audience can play together, give some people a laugh, and remind us that when it comes to mental health support - we aren't really alone - not now, not ever.
